Eligibility Requirements for Supervisees

  • Enrolled in or graduated from a master’s or doctoral program in a mental health field. Begin supervision only after graduate school enrollment and engagement with clients. 

  • Hold an active AASECT membership at supervision start and maintain it throughout

  • Begin supervision only after graduate school enrollment

  • Have a signed supervision contract with the AMARE Institute 

  • For 10-year track: Provide verifiable documentation of 10+ years of clinical sex therapy experience (~20 hrs/week)

Group supervision focuses on clinical casework, ethics, countertransference, and skill development. Supervisees are expected to attend group supervision with questions and/or case consultations.

Didactic components may be included as supplements; when provided, these hours count towards Sex Therapy Knowledge Areas.

Required Written Summary
(for Certification Application)

All supervisees must prepare a comprehensive narrative summary including:

  • Theoretical orientation in sex therapy

  • Couples therapy models used

  • Service delivery settings (clinic, telehealth, etc.)

  • Case types and populations treated (e.g., trauma survivors, LGBTQ+, OCSB)

  • Teaching, training, and lecturing experience (if any)

  • Relevant training or certifications completed

  • Membership in professional organizations

Evaluation & Completion

Supervisees are evaluated on:

  • Clinical readiness

  • Case conceptualization

  • Cultural and sexual diversity competence

  • Professionalism and ethical standards.

At completion, a Final Supervision Summary and/or endorsement letter will be provided (if criteria are met).
